Latest Patents

One of his latest patents is a method for selective dealkylation of alkyl-substituted C9+ aromatic compounds using a bimodal porous dealkylation catalyst at low temperature. This method involves a catalyst with a bimodal porous structure, which includes both mesopores and micropores. The catalyst, comprising a crystalline aluminosilicate and a metal, demonstrates high activity at low temperatures. This environmentally friendly process allows for the selective dealkylation of C9+ aromatic compounds, converting them into valuable products like BTX while reducing waste treatment costs compared to traditional methods.

Another notable patent involves chiral salen catalysts and methods for preparing chiral compounds from racemic epoxides. This invention provides novel chiral salen catalysts that can produce chiral compounds with high optical purity. These catalysts can be reused continuously without requiring activation, maintaining their catalytic activity and minimizing racemization after reactions. This innovation is particularly beneficial for the production of chiral medicines and food additives on a large scale.
